Do You Really Need a Car at CUNY?

Before diving into shipping logistics, ask yourself an important question: Do I truly need a car in New York City? CUNY’s campuses are well integrated into the city’s robust public transportation system. Between subways, buses, and bike-sharing programs, many students get by just fine without a personal vehicle. However, for those commuting from outside the five boroughs or traveling frequently, a car might offer needed flexibility. Weigh the cost of parking, insurance, and fuel against the convenience it provides.

Researching and Choosing a Reliable Auto Transporter

Finding a trustworthy car shipping service is a crucial step in the process. Be sure to look for companies that are licensed and bonded. Customer reviews on sites like the Better Business Bureau and Yelp can offer useful insights into customer experiences and satisfaction. Additionally, you can verify a company’s credentials through the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) an official U.S. government agency responsible for regulating vehicle transport. Use their database to check safety records and insurance information.

Open vs. Enclosed Shipping: What’s Best for You?

When it comes to shipping, you’ll typically choose between open transport and enclosed transport. Open transport is the more affordable and common option, where your car is transported on an open-air trailer along with several others. It’s efficient and cost-effective but leaves your car exposed to the elements. Enclosed transport offers better protection, ideal for high-end or classic vehicles, but comes at a higher cost. Evaluate your vehicle type, budget, and weather considerations when making your decision.

Budgeting: Understanding Costs and Quotes

Car shipping costs vary depending on the distance, time of year, fuel prices, and the size of your vehicle. The average cost to ship a car across the U.S. ranges between $600 and $1,200. When getting quotes, ensure the estimate includes all potential fees and ask whether the price is binding or subject to change. Some companies offer student discounts, so don’t hesitate to inquire.

Preparing Your Car for Transport

Preparation is key for a smooth shipping experience. First, clean your car thoroughly inside and out so the transport company can inspect it accurately. Document the current condition with photos from multiple angles. Remove all personal belongings and disable or remove toll tags. Make sure the gas tank is no more than a quarter full and that the battery is charged. A quick mechanical check-up can prevent breakdowns during loading or unloading.

Coordinating Pickup and Delivery

Once your shipping is booked, work closely with the company to schedule convenient pickup and delivery times. You’ll often have the choice between door-to-door delivery (where they come to your home or campus) and terminal-to-terminal delivery (which may be cheaper but requires additional travel to drop off or pick up your car). At delivery, inspect your vehicle carefully before signing off, and report any damage immediately to avoid delays in compensation claims.

Navigating Vehicle Regulations on Campus

Each CUNY campus has its own rules regarding student vehicles, so make sure you understand parking policies, registration requirements, and associated costs. Some campuses have limited or no parking for undergraduates, while others offer student permits for designated lots. Contact your campus’s transportation or public safety office well in advance to avoid violations or unnecessary fees.

The Secret Life of Hidden Water Leaks: More Than Just a Drip

Yes, we’ve all battled a dripping faucet or dealt with a weeping water heater. However, the real troublemakers are often masters of disguise, forming hidden water leaks that lurk unseen in the shadows of your walls and under your floorboards. Before you grab your toolbox and channel your inner demolition expert, here’s a pro tip: Your water meter might just be the Sherlock Holmes you need.

Find that little colored leak indicator located next to the meter hand. If it’s doing the cha-cha while your taps are off, you might have a stealthy hidden water leak on your hands. This simple check can save you thousands in repairs if it leads to early identification of a significant issue.

Design Meets Function: The Benefits of Acoustic Slat Wall Panels

To create acoustic slat wall panels, medium-density fiberboard (MDF) slats adhere to a recycled felt backing. This combo improves your space in several ways.

Visual Warmth and Modern Style

  • Natural wood finishes like walnut or oak
  • Vertical or horizontal layout options
  • Seamless integration with shelving or hooks

Acoustic Performance That Works

  • Reduces echoes in open rooms
  • Absorbs sound for a quieter space
  • Ideal for home offices, studios, and entertainment rooms

Simple Installation for DIY or Pros

Acoustic slat wall panels are easy to install for both experts and do-it-yourselfers.

Three Installation Methods

  1. Direct to Wall—Use screws (black screws work best for blending into the felt backing).
  2. Adhesive mounting provides a less permanent solution.
  3. Over Battens—Increases acoustic performance by leaving an air gap.

Tools You Might Need

  • Electric saw (for cutting around outlets or fixtures)
  • Measuring tape
  • Screwdriver or drill

What to Know Before You Install

Preparation is key when working with acoustic slat wall panels. Here’s a list of considerations to ensure your project goes smoothly:

  • Room Conditions: Install in dry, climate-controlled areas to prevent warping.
  • Wall Prep: Clean and level the surface before mounting.
  • Safety First: Cut panels outdoors or in ventilated spaces due to dust from felt and MDF.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Not locating studs before screwing in
  • Forgetting to leave space for wall fixtures
  • Using incompatible screws or adhesives

Top Flooring Types That Match Wood Paneling

Discover flooring styles that balance, contrast, or enhance wood-paneled walls.

1. Hardwood Flooring: Classic Meets Character

Hardwood floors are a natural pairing with wood paneling. They offer timeless appeal, durability, and elegance. To get the best flooring for wood paneling, match your floor’s grain or stain with the wall paneling—or create contrast with opposing shades for visual drama.

Why choose it?

  • Seamless texture coordination
  • Long-lasting and easily refinished
  • Available in various tones and finishes

2. Laminate Flooring: Stylish Yet Cost-Effective

Laminate mimics the look of hardwood, stone, or tile at a fraction of the cost. It’s ideal for budget-conscious homeowners who still want the best flooring for wood paneling in terms of variety and visual appeal. Designers love using

carpet choices

to create contrast that highlights the grain and color of wood paneling.

Benefits:

  • Scratch-resistant and great for high-traffic areas
  • Wide selection of wood-like patterns
  • Easy installation and upkeep

3. Stone or Tile: Natural Contrast

Want to create an upscale look with an unexpected twist? Go for tile or stone. Marble, slate, or ceramic tiles bring cool tones that contrast beautifully with warm, rustic paneling. This pairing is one of the best flooring for wood paneling in kitchens and bathrooms.

Perks:

  • Water-resistant and durable
  • Elegant and modern touch
  • Works well in damp or humid spaces

4. Carpet: Soft and Inviting

Carpet brings warmth and softness to wood-paneled rooms, especially bedrooms and lounges. Stick to muted or neutral tones to let your wall paneling shine.

Best practices:

  • Choose looped textures like Berber or soft shag
  • Stick with grays, taupes, and earth tones
  • Avoid overly bold patterns that clash with panel grain

5. Polished Concrete: Sleek and Contemporary

If you love industrial interiors, concrete floors offer one of the best flooring for wood paneling in modern homes. Its smooth, cold finish plays beautifully against the warmth and texture of wood-paneled walls.

Design tip: Add area rugs or cozy textiles to soften the overall aesthetic.

6. Vinyl Flooring: Durable and Diverse

Vinyl is moisture-resistant, versatile, and a great alternative to hardwood or tile. From wood-look vinyl planks to stone visuals, this is among the best flooring for wood paneling in active family homes or rental properties.

Advantages:

  • Easy to clean and water-resistant
  • Available in peel-and-stick or click-lock formats
  • Compatible with radiant heating
